Transaction 73309266c8e77b2b76bb7939777453a238503424bf38824dac0eb7d8449881bd
1 Input
1 Output
-
73309266c8e77b2b76bb7939777453a238503424bf38824dac0eb7d8449881bd:0
- value
- 221147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fdf29a041034fec6e467e40550c0a648a058a9e OP_EQUAL
- address
- 3BtYGSqfLbdeTuRmetkBAEfARdsKkGkwWT